On average, a glass curtain wall is going to cost between $25 to $140+ per square foot. This cost will depend on the type of glass being used, the degree of transparency, the design, the thickness, and
For instance, the average cost of a unitized curtain wall is around $104.9 per square foot, while a double-glazed window wall with insulated slab bypass and interior foam insulation costs
